Our Retail Survey Results Are In - 83% of 196 Local Retailers Don't Want Tesco

Back on 22nd March, an article appeared in the Herts Advertiser in which Tesco stated that it had carried out a survey of local businesses and that a significant majority were in favour of having a Tesco superstore built on the old Eversheds site on London Road.

We here at Stop Tesco were not entirely convinced, so we carried out our own survey of retailers in St Albans. We went out and about and visited 196 retailers. We went up and down London Road and Victoria Street, Alma Road and Lattimore Road, and the Maltings Shopping Centre. We also spoke to all of the market stall holders at the Saturday Market and the Farmers’ Market.

And guess what? We were correct in our assumption. We asked 196 businesses “Are you in favour of the proposed Tesco Superstore on the Eversheds site?” and they told us “NO” in no uncertain terms. 83% of the retailers who took part in our survey do NOT want a Tesco store on London Road.

Our retailers fell into many different categories. Those falling into the “Other” category including toy shops, shoe repair, finance and insurance advice, stationers, newsagents, luggage, mobile phones, dry cleaning, pet food and fabric retailers.

We also did not find one single business that said that they had been part of Tesco’s “survey”.
